The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s requiring Prototyping sk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 1 December 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
1 Dec 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 355 324 322
Rank change year-on-year -31 -2 -58
Permanent jobs citing Prototyping 326 536 478
As % of all permanent jobs in the UK 0.60% 0.83% 0.94%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 0.72% 0.97% 1.01%
Number of salaries quoted 193 243 343
10th Percentile £46,708 £42,500 £32,750
25th Percentile £51,250 £52,500 £47,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£70,000 £65,000 £65,000
Median % change year-on-year +7.69% - -3.70%
75th Percentile £96,375 £77,500 £78,750
90th Percentile £120,000 £87,000 £94,750
UK excluding London median annual salary £57,500 £65,000 £55,000
% change year-on-year -11.54% +18.18% -15.38%
